Output 576efbc67c4b0b0f95abe57833e5f21d6ceb3b4717a98a872df06b5bf6d5332d:0

value
636000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b0ab13f86c10aa812420533b73105a633acf2e OP_EQUAL
address
3MzVaFrcnSYrANGVqrCxNEoHYEfzjbnMVY
transaction
576efbc67c4b0b0f95abe57833e5f21d6ceb3b4717a98a872df06b5bf6d5332d
spent
true